828 Traditional Proverbs / Page 47
- 461. No man is an island, but some of us are long peninsulas.
 - 462. No man is infallible.
 - 463. No matter how hard you throw a dead fish in the water, it still won't swim.
 - 464. No names, no pack-drill.
 - 465. No one can pray well, but those who live well.
 - 466. No one is as angry as the person who is wrong.
 - 467. No one is worse, for knowing the worst of themselves.
 - 468. No one knows what the dinner was after the plates have been washed.
 - 469. No one with a good catch of fish goes home by the back alley.
 - 470. No pillows so soft as God's Promise.
